About Acuity message menus

When the monitor first establishes communication with Acuity and the clinician selects to
start a new patient, the monitor presents a series of screens to determine the location
(unit and room number) and the name and ID number of the monitored patient. If the
patient is already known to Acuity, you can select the identifying information from a series
of lists. If the patient is new to Acuity, you provide the information.

If the clinician is continuing to monitor the same patient, these Acuity message menus
are not presented.

First, the monitor displays a list of units. Highlight the unit for this patient and press

.

Figure 78. Acuity unit list

The monitor then displays a list of patients.

Caution Do not leave a wireless monitor that is turned on outside of its wireless
communication area for more than four hours.

If your facility has unusual clinical workflows that require wireless devices to be
off of the network for extended periods, do one or more of the following:

Extend the wireless coverage area to include areas where devices stay for
longer periods of time. For example, include wireless coverage in the Post
Cardiac Cath, X-Ray, and MRI areas.

When a monitor moves to a stand-alone environment, configure the device
in the stand-alone mode. This disables the radio card for use in the
stand-alone work environment.

Before removing monitors from a wireless coverage area, disconnect them
from the wireless infrastructure. Propaq LT monitors include this software
feature for clinicians.

Note

Some of these menus can contain lists that are too long to fit on the screen. To
view or highlight list items that are not on the screen, press

or

repeatedly

as needed scroll the list.
